Laura Robson, the former junior Wimbledon champion and Olympic silver medallist, has retired from tennis at the age of 28. After returning to full-time tennis in January 2016 post-injury, Robson struggled with form and did not return to the top 150 in singles tennis. Former British No 1 Laura Robson has announced her retirement from tennis following three hip operations. For 2011, Robson hired a new coach, Frenchman Patrick Mouratoglou, and moved her working base to Paris. Britain's former junior Wimbledon champion and Olympic mixed doubles silver medallist Laura Robson announced her retirement on Monday due to persistent injury problems. I've sort of known that for a while because of what I was told by the doctors last year, but it took me so long to say it to myself, which is why it took me so long to say it officially. It has also been announced today that Robson has taken up a role in the Professional Tennis team at the AELTC working on international player relations.
